A data model is the conceptual blueprint defining how data is structured, related, and constrained, while a schema is the physical implementation of that model in a database. Used by architects to design systems and by developers to build queries, this distinction helps teams align business rules with technical storage. Data engineers, analysts, and DBAs benefit from avoiding costly redesigns.
